Gameplay and Mechanics
WingChun is designed for two to four players, making it ideal for both intimate duels and larger tactical showdowns. The game is played on a hexagonal board, which represents the dojo, a place where combat takes place. The board's hexagonal tiles themselves provide a strategic element, as players must navigate obstacles and opportunities to gain the upper hand.
Each player starts with an equal number of units, representing their martial artists. These units are equipped with unique abilities that reflect different aspects of Wing Chun techniques, from blocks and strikes to evasive maneuvers. Players take turns to move their units across the board, attempting to outmaneuver their opponents while defending their territory.
A typical turn involves several phases: planning, executing moves, and engaging in combat. During the planning phase, players secretly select their intended actions for the turn, creating a simultaneous and unpredictable exchange when moves are revealed. This aspect of hidden movement ensures that players remain engaged, always anticipating their opponent's next move.

Rules and Objectives
As with many strategy games, understanding the rules of WingChun is crucial for success. The primary objective is to either eliminate the opponent's martial artists or secure strategic points on the board. Victory conditions are flexible, allowing players to tailor the game length and complexity to their preferences.
